Leadership’s Role in Shaping Culture:

  • Setting the Tone: Mindful leaders create safe, productive, and enjoyable work environments. Championing work-life balance sets a positive example for the entire workforce.
  • Flexible Work Arrangements: Embrace flexible work arrangements like remote work and flexible hours to empower employees and contribute to a more balanced lifestyle.

Communication Strategies:

  • Transparent Policies: Communicate organizational policies on work-life balance transparently, fostering trust and empowering employees to manage their time effectively.
  • Regular Check-ins: Schedule regular check-ins with employees to discuss workload, stress levels, and challenges, fostering open communication and support.

Transformational Leadership for Work-Life Balance:

  • Creating Safe Spaces: Explore how transformational leadership creates safe spaces for teams to discuss work-life balance openly, promoting understanding and support.
  • Defining Success: Define what a successful work-life balance looks like for your team, aligning organizational goals with personal well-being.
  • Tools for Building a Balanced Culture: Develop tools such as training programs and stress management resources to build a culture that promotes balance.
